a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orChris Lu <chris.lu@gmail.com>2019-02-15 10:01:16 -0800
committerChris Lu <chris.lu@gmail.com>2019-02-15 10:01:16 -0800
commit712a0e19c8d5543d13033058d8a15e7f53488af4 (patch)
tree4de3faf08389417de4941e37db0b6737908d3e1a
parent157c0f7c011816a817e56da7fd0fb7fa3a337aee (diff)
parent2ec6a679c2e86c437d5fd826bc119b6b9855f740 (diff)
downloadseaweedfs-712a0e19c8d5543d13033058d8a15e7f53488af4.tar.xz
seaweedfs-712a0e19c8d5543d13033058d8a15e7f53488af4.zip
Merge branch 'master' into add_jwt
-rw-r--r--weed/filesys/file.go4
1 files changed, 4 insertions, 0 deletions
diff --git a/weed/filesys/file.go b/weed/filesys/file.go
index 6c07345a0..812137fe2 100644
--- a/weed/filesys/file.go
+++ b/weed/filesys/file.go
@@ -105,6 +105,10 @@ func (file *File) Setattr(ctx context.Context, req *fuse.SetattrRequest, resp *f
file.entry.Attributes.Mtime = req.Mtime.Unix()
}
+ if file.isOpen {
+ return nil
+ }
+
return file.wfs.withFilerClient(func(client filer_pb.SeaweedFilerClient) error {
request := &filer_pb.UpdateEntryRequest{